Severe Threat Monday? Slight Cool Down Afterwords

Good Friday evening to all! We just came out of two straight severe weather days where strong and severe storms were kept to more of a spotty threat and not everyone got in on the strong storms. Those are the situations we like the best! Since we're coming out of a harsh winter, everyone wants to know where do we go from here? Another cool down or is the spring like temperatures a permanent thing?

First off, the weekend looks great with high temperatures generally running in the mid 60's with sunny skies for the most part. I'm focusing on Monday as we see another potential severe weather threat for the area. We're still two days out and the details are few and far between. One thing for certain is there will be a lot of moisture available and this could lead to yet another flooding potential for areas that have already been waterlogged, but so far confidence is low in a widespread severe weather event.

Beyond the Monday potential severe weather threat we'll see a slight cool down for your Tuesday, and Wednesday. This will be due to a passing strong cold front in which will bring a cooler and much drier brand of air into the area from southern Canada. You can expect dry conditions with highs in the low 50's on Tuesday and mid 50's on Wednesday. Thursday and Friday will feel spring like once again with high temperatures into the low 70's with Friday having a chance for general thunderstorms. This will be due to an influx of moisture streaming northward out of the Gulf of Mexico. By the weekend, there could be enough instability to spark a severe weather threat but that's 7+ days away and confidence in a severe weather threat is very low.
